đ§âď¸ Getting Started: Gear & Setup
You donât need a truckload of gear to get started. A medium-power spinning rod with fast action gives you control and sensitivity. Pair it with a 2500â3000 size reel, 8â12lb fluorocarbon leader, and jigheads suited to surf conditions (5â7g for deeper water, 2â3g for calmer spots).
Top soft plastic styles for beach fishing:
- Paddle tails â mimic swimming baitfish; great for slow rolls
- Curly tails â swim naturally with minimal movement
- Shrimp imitations â deadly on flathead and bream

đ Technique Tips for the Surf Zone
Beach fishing is dynamicâconditions change with tides, wind, and light. Here are some techniques tailored for women who want to fish smart and stylish:
- Double Hop: Cast, let it sink, then lift the rod tip twice. Mimics a startled baitfish.
- Slow Roll: Steady retrieve with the rod tip low. Ideal for paddle tails.
- Hybrid Retrieve: Mix hops, pauses, and rolls to trigger hesitant fish.
Pro tip: Watch your line bellyâoften youâll see the bite before you feel it!
